Flexible U-Frame Payload Layout
The U Series is intended for applications where the customer already has camera modules, processors, radar interfaces or customized sensor housings.
The integration structure can be adapted for:
- Single central payload
- Dual-sensor EO/IR payload
- Separate visible and thermal housings
- Thermal camera plus laser rangefinder
- Wide-angle search camera plus telephoto verification camera
- Customer-developed processor and tracking module
- Additional GPS, inertial or orientation devices
The final mounting design should be based on payload dimensions, total weight, center of gravity and required field of movement.
High-Speed Tracking and Target Handoff
Direct-drive motion allows the PTU to respond quickly when receiving new pointing coordinates. With pan acceleration up to 300°/s² and tilt acceleration up to 240°/s², it can support fast repositioning in anti-drone, perimeter and mobile-target observation workflows.
Actual tracking performance depends on the complete system, including sensor frame rate, lens field of view, detection algorithm, controller latency, communication update rate and target dynamics.
EO/IR and Laser Payload Integration
The U Series can support project-specific integration of:
- Visible zoom cameras
- Cooled or uncooled thermal imagers
- Laser rangefinders
- Laser illumination modules
- Wide-angle detection cameras
- AI tracking processors
- Radar or command-system interfaces
Optical axes, sensor centerlines and parallax should be evaluated according to the expected working distance and verification workflow.
Control and Feedback
Standard communication interfaces include RS485 and RS422 with PELCO-D support. Customized communication commands, network control, angle feedback formats and system linkage can be evaluated according to customer requirements.
For radar-guided operation, the integration review should define:
- Coordinate format
- Azimuth and elevation reference
- Update frequency
- Pointing-command latency
- Angle feedback
- Target-handoff logic
- Reacquisition workflow
Outdoor and Critical-Site Deployment
The PTU is designed for operation between -40°C and +60°C, with IP66 protection and surge-resistant power input. It is suitable for fixed and mobile installations in:
- Counter-UAS systems
- Airport perimeter surveillance
- Border and coastal monitoring
- Critical infrastructure protection
- Vehicle-mounted surveillance
- Vessel and unmanned-platform projects
- Industrial site security
- Long-range EO/IR observation
Application-specific corrosion resistance, shock and vibration protection, heater systems or marine coatings should be confirmed separately.
